Guido van Rossum47b9ff62006-08-24 00:41:19 +0000506/* The new comparison philosophy is: we completely separate three-way
507 comparison from rich comparison. That is, PyObject_Compare() and
508 PyObject_Cmp() *just* use the tp_compare slot. And PyObject_RichCompare()
509 and PyObject_RichCompareBool() *just* use the tp_richcompare slot.
510
511 See (*) below for practical amendments.
512
513 IOW, only cmp() uses tp_compare; the comparison operators (==, !=, <=, <,
514 >=, >) only use tp_richcompare. Note that list.sort() only uses <.
515
516 (And yes, eventually we'll rip out cmp() and tp_compare.)
517
518 The calling conventions are different: tp_compare only gets called with two
519 objects of the appropriate type; tp_richcompare gets called with a first
520 argument of the appropriate type and a second object of an arbitrary type.
521 We never do any kind of coercion.
522
523 The return conventions are also different.
524
525 The tp_compare slot should return a C int, as follows:
526
527 -1 if a < b or if an exception occurred
528 0 if a == b
529 +1 if a > b
530
531 No other return values are allowed. PyObject_Compare() has the same
532 calling convention.
533
534 The tp_richcompare slot should return an object, as follows:
535
536 NULL if an exception occurred
537 NotImplemented if the requested comparison is not implemented
538 any other false value if the requested comparison is false
539 any other true value if the requested comparison is true
540
541 The PyObject_RichCompare[Bool]() wrappers raise TypeError when they get
542 NotImplemented.
543
544 (*) Practical amendments:
545
546 - If rich comparison returns NotImplemented, == and != are decided by
547 comparing the object pointer (i.e. falling back to the base object
548 implementation).
549
550 - If three-way comparison is not implemented, it falls back on rich
551 comparison (but not the other way around!).
552
Guido van Rossuma4073002002-05-31 20:03:54 +0000553*/

Fred Drake13634cf2000-06-29 19:17:04 +0000750/* Set of hash utility functions to help maintaining the invariant that
Raymond Hettinger8183fa42004-03-21 17:35:06 +0000751 if a==b then hash(a)==hash(b)
Fred Drake13634cf2000-06-29 19:17:04 +0000752
753 All the utility functions (_Py_Hash*()) return "-1" to signify an error.
754*/

Guido van Rossum86610361998-04-10 22:32:46 +00001723/* These methods are used to control infinite recursion in repr, str, print,
1724 etc. Container objects that may recursively contain themselves,
1725 e.g. builtin dictionaries and lists, should used Py_ReprEnter() and
1726 Py_ReprLeave() to avoid infinite recursion.
1727
1728 Py_ReprEnter() returns 0 the first time it is called for a particular
1729 object and 1 every time thereafter. It returns -1 if an exception
1730 occurred. Py_ReprLeave() has no return value.
1731
1732 See dictobject.c and listobject.c for examples of use.
1733*/
